Malkapet reservoir trial run held successfully

KARIMNAGAR: Irrigation department officials successfully conducted the Malkapet reservoir trial run which was built with a capacity of 3 tmc of water under the package-9 of the Kaleshwaram Lift Irrigation Scheme (KLIS) project in Malkapet village of Konaraopet mandal in Rajanna Sircilla district on Tuesday.

With orders from the IT minister and Sircilla MLA K.T. Rama Rao, officials accelerated the work by deploying additional labour and working day and night for the past week days, coordinating various departments, and completing the work by lifting the Godavari water into the reservoir at 7 a.m.

The activities were monitored by the Engineer-in-Chief N. Venkateshwarlu and lift irrigation advisor Penta Reddy, as well as representatives from the MRKR and WPL agencies, in accordance with the district collector Anurag Jayanti's instructions about the successful completion of the Malkapet reservoir trial run.

Srinivas Reddy, the executive engineer of the package-9 of the KLIS project, who coordinated the trail run, stated that with the completion of construction works on the Malkapet reservoir, water for irrigation needs will be supplied to around 60,000 acres of land, as well as the stabilisation of around 26,150 acres of ayacut land present under the reservoir.

The construction of Malkapet reservoir has solved the problems of farmers in two constituencies, Vemulawada and Sircilla, who were facing a severe shortage of water for irrigation purposes, and all of the barren land in the district will soon become fertile due to the Godavari water supply. The officials said that the inauguration ceremony for the Malkapet reservoir, constructed at a cost of '504 crore will take place shortly.
